    Digital Devices and Their Functions

    • Digital devices function by accepting inputs, processing that information, and producing outputs.
    • Examples of inputs include pressing keys on a keyboard, while outputs are displayed on the screen.

    Input, Process, Output Model

    • Each digital device operates on the I-P-O (Input, Process, Output) model.
    • Example: Pressing the ‘H’ key results in the input being processed to display 'H' on the screen.

    Cyber Attacks

    • Cyber attacks are attempts by criminals to steal online information without the owner's consent.
    • Awareness of these threats is crucial for online security.

    Secure Passwords

    • A secure password is essential for protecting digital information.
    • Among given examples, the password "Dogc&tmeAn25" is likely the most secure due to its complexity.
